YO18 7EH is a safe, established residential area on The Avenue, 1.0km from Southgate in Pickering. Administratively it sits within Pickering ward and the Thirsk and Malton constituency.
One of the more sought-after postcodes in YO18, YO18 7EH offers a diverse rural area with a mix of families, workers and retirees. By day, the area transitions to a mining and quarrying facilities character: industrial activities connected with mining and quarrying. An average age of 44 puts this squarely in mixed-family territory — professional couples, school-age children households, and established residents all sharing the streets. 72% of residents own their home — above average for the district, consistent with a stable and sought-after address.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 28 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Average house prices are around £305k.
Census 2021 statistics for YO18 7EH are sourced from Output Area E00141565 (shared with 73 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.

gavel Crime Overview 12 Months (up to 2026-02)
YO18 7EH has low crime rates — 28 incidents per 1,000 residents. The most reported categories are violence and sexual offences and anti-social behaviour. Commercial streets and transport hubs naturally generate more incidents than quiet residential roads.
